Scarisbrick Parish Council Grant Application Form. Page 1
Scarisbrick Parish Council –Grant Application
Scarisbrick Parish Council can offer financial grants, subject to availability of funds, intended to support locally based groups, organisations, or events that will benefit residents in the Parish of Scarisbrick. The purpose of any grant awarded by the Council is to support initiatives in the local community that are not otherwise funded by the Council. The annual budget for this purpose is limited and unfortunately substantial grants cannot be made available. Grants are therefore likely to be restricted to amounts up to £150. 18/51... REPLACEMENT LAPTOP
The Clerk explained that he had sought quotes from different suppliers. However in a fast moving market the cost was changing on a daily basis and there are difficulties obtaining quotes for identical machines. The Clerk explained that the laptop would require government standard operating systems which limited the system to Windows Pro. The most competitive quote is for a 1-IP 250 laptop running Windows Pro at £416.
It was resolved to authorise the purchase of a replacement laptop to the value of £416.
18/52 ... CLERKS REPORT
The Clerk attended and completed Finance Training in February.
The Clerk has written to the local primary schools to ask if they are prepared to contribute to the Cinder track at the Village Hall, using the funds received from the sugar tax. St Marks have replied. They have already spent the money on developing a 'Forest School' to provide pupils with an outdoor teaching environment.
The Clerk has met with Mr Formby and necessary declaration has been completed. Lancashire County Council has been asked to provide their Gully Cleaning Policy.
The Clerk has confirmed with St Marks Parent and Child group that a Child Protection policy is in place.
A reply has been received from the Police and Crime Commissioner in relation to parking and PACT meetings. Briefly the Commissioner advises that parking enforcement is no longer the responsibility of the Police and that the reduction in Police staff has had an impact on the ability to resource PACT meetings.
It was resolved to write to the local Police Area Commander to ascertain if a Neighbourhood Policing solution could be implemented to address the obstruction issues on Southport Road.
